Piling repair services involve assessing and restoring the structural integrity of building foundations by addressing issues related to the underlying piles. Piles are long, column-like supports driven into the ground to stabilize structures, especially in areas with weak or shifting soil. Over time, these piles can experience deterioration, movement, or damage due to soil settling, water erosion, or other environmental factors. Repair services typically include techniques such as pile jacking, underpinning, or reinforcement to ensure the foundation remains stable and secure. These methods are tailored to address specific problems, restoring the load-bearing capacity of the foundation and preventing further structural issues.

This service helps resolve common foundation problems caused by compromised piles, such as uneven settling, cracks in walls or floors, and structural wobbliness. When piles weaken or shift, they can lead to significant damage in a building’s framework, posing safety risks and increasing repair costs if left unaddressed. Piling repair services aim to stabilize the foundation, prevent further movement, and preserve the overall integrity of the property. These repairs are critical in maintaining the safety and longevity of structures, especially in regions prone to soil movement or water-related issues.

The overview below groups typical Piling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Jefferson County, WI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ost Range for Piling Repair - The typical cost for piling repair services can vary from $1,500 to $5,000 per piling, depending on the extent of damage and the method used. For example, minor repairs may be closer to $1,500, while extensive work can reach higher prices.

Factors Influencing Costs - Prices are influenced by factors such as soil conditions, pile type, and accessibility. Repairs in difficult-to-access areas or with complex soil conditions tend to be more expensive, often exceeding $4,000 per pile.

Average Project Expenses - The average cost for repairing multiple piles in a residential foundation ranges from $10,000 to $25,000. Larger commercial projects or extensive repairs can cost significantly more, depending on the scope of work.

Cost Variability - Overall costs vary based on the size and number of piles, with some projects costing less than $1,000 per pile for minor fixes, while major repairs or replacements may surpass $10,000 per pile. Local pros can provide specific estimates based on individual project need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s of foundation or piling issues? Common indicators include u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, visible cracks in walls or the foundation, and noticeable tilting or sinking of structures.

How long does piling repair typically take? The duration depends on the extent of the damage and the repair method, but local contractors can provide estimates based on specific conditions.

Are piling repairs necessary for all foundation problems? Not necessarily; a professional assessment can determine if piling repair is needed or if other foundation repair options are appropriate.

What types of piling repair methods are available? Repair options may include underpinning, piling replacement, or stabilization techniques, depending on the severity and type of damage.
